Connect a DeWalt random-orbit sander stepped port to a Festool D36 antistatic hose
How to join a DeWalt random-orbit sander stepped port to a Festool D36 antistatic hose, and what stops it leaking dust.
Not a direct fit. Joining the DeWalt random-orbit sander stepped port to a Festool D36 antistatic hose needs a 26 / 32 / 35 mm to 36 mm step reducer.

Shop notes
Measured across the joint between the DeWalt random-orbit sander stepped port and the Festool D36 antistatic hose, the hose (38 mm) is 3 mm larger than the port (35 mm), so the port rattles inside without gripping. A 26 / 32 / 35 mm to 36 mm step reducer closes that 3 mm step so the two hold together instead of leaking at the gap.
A 3 mm mismatch feels close enough to force, and it will hold for a minute before it works loose under airflow. Fit the step ring rather than trusting friction on a gap this size.
